Cobo MM, Moultrie F, Hauck AGV, Crankshaw D, Monk V, Hartley C, Evans Fry R, Robinson S, van der Vaart M, Baxter L, Adams E, Poorun R, Bhatt A, Slater R. Multicentre, randomised controlled trial to investigate the effects of parental touch on relieving acute procedural pain in neonates (Petal). BMJ Open 2022; 12:e061841. Abstract
INTRODUCTION Newborn infants routinely undergo minor painful procedures as part of postnatal care, with infants born sick or premature requiring a greater number of procedures. As pain in early life can have long-term neurodevelopmental consequences and lead to parental anxiety and future avoidance of interventions, effective pain management is essential. Non-pharmacological comfort measures such as breastfeeding, swaddling and sweet solutions are inconsistently implemented and are not always practical or effective in reducing the transmission of noxious input to the brain. Stroking of the skin can activate C-tactile fibres and reduce pain, and therefore could provide a simple and safe parent-led intervention for the management of pain. The trial aim is to determine whether parental touch prior to a painful clinical procedure provides effective pain relief in neonates. METHODS AND ANALYSIS This is a multicentre randomised controlled trial. A total of 112 neonates born at 35 weeks' gestation or more requiring a blood test in the first week of life will be recruited and randomised to receive parental stroking either preprocedure or postprocedure. We will record brain activity (EEG), cardiac and respiratory dynamics, oxygen saturation and facial expression to provide proxy pain outcome measures. The primary outcome will be the reduction of noxious-evoked brain activity in response to a heel lance. Secondary outcomes will be a reduction in clinical pain scores (Premature Infant Pain Profile-Revised), postprocedural tachycardia and parental anxiety. Costa TMDS, Oliveira EDS, Silva BVSD, Melo EBBD, Carvalho FOD, Duarte FHDS, Dantas RAN, Dantas DV. Massage for pain relief in newborns submitted to puncture: systematic review. Rev Gaucha Enferm 2022; 43:e20220029. Abstract
ABSTRACT Objective To analyze in the scientific literature the effects of massage on pain relief in newborns submitted to puncture. Method Systematic review with meta-analysis performed in October 2020, using PubMed, Web of Science, CINAHL, Scopus, Cochrane and Gale databases. Studies without time frame were included, which used massage as the main technique for relieving neonatal pain during puncture. Data were extracted using standardized forms and the synthesis of results occurred in a descriptive way. Results From the 12 studies included, massage was effective in pain relief in 83.3% of the studies. The comparative meta-analysis of massage versus routine care that assessed duration of crying obtained a statistically significant result (p = 0.0002; 95% CI -85.51 to -27.09). Conclusion Massage contributes to neonatal pain relief by reducing pain score and reducing crying time in newborns submitted to puncture.

Basso JC, Satyal MK, Rugh R. Dance on the Brain: Enhancing Intra- and Inter-Brain Synchrony. Front Hum Neurosci 2021; 14:584312. Abstract
Dance has traditionally been viewed from a Eurocentric perspective as a mode of self-expression that involves the human body moving through space, performed for the purposes of art, and viewed by an audience. In this Hypothesis and Theory article, we synthesize findings from anthropology, sociology, psychology, dance pedagogy, and neuroscience to propose The Synchronicity Hypothesis of Dance, which states that humans dance to enhance both intra- and inter-brain synchrony. We outline a neurocentric definition of dance, which suggests that dance involves neurobehavioral processes in seven distinct areas including sensory, motor, cognitive, social, emotional, rhythmic, and creative. We explore The Synchronicity Hypothesis of Dance through several avenues. First, we examine evolutionary theories of dance, which suggest that dance drives interpersonal coordination. Second, we examine fundamental movement patterns, which emerge throughout development and are omnipresent across cultures of the world. Third, we examine how each of the seven neurobehaviors increases intra- and inter-brain synchrony. Fourth, we examine the neuroimaging literature on dance to identify the brain regions most involved in and affected by dance. The findings presented here support our hypothesis that we engage in dance for the purpose of intrinsic reward, which as a result of dance-induced increases in neural synchrony, leads to enhanced interpersonal coordination. This hypothesis suggests that dance may be helpful to repattern oscillatory activity, leading to clinical improvements in autism spectrum disorder and other disorders with oscillatory activity impairments. Finally, we offer suggestions for future directions and discuss the idea that our consciousness can be redefined not just as an individual process but as a shared experience that we can positively influence by dancing together.

Misra SM, Monico E, Kao G, Guffey D, Kim E, Khatker M, Gilbert C, Biard M, Marcus M, Roth I, Giardino AP. Addressing Pain With Inpatient Integrative Medicine at a Large Children's Hospital. Clin Pediatr (Phila) 2019; 58:738-745. Abstract
BACKGROUND Pediatric integrative medicine (IM) includes the use of therapies not considered mainstream to help alleviate symptoms such as pain and anxiety. These therapies can be provided in the inpatient setting. METHODS This 10-week study involved the integration of acupuncture, biofeedback, clinical hypnotherapy, guided imagery, meditation, and music therapy to address pain in children admitted to a large US children's hospital. RESULTS Of 51 patients enrolled, 60% of the patients, 66% of their mothers, and 56% of their fathers used CAM (complementary and alternative medicine) in the preceding 1 year. Although 51 families requested integrative therapies, only 18 patients received them because of inadequate provider availability. All recorded pain scores improved with integrative therapies. One parent reported a possible side effect of irritability in the child after clinical hypnotherapy while 5 children reported opiate side effects. All participating families interviewed responded that IM services helped their child's pain and helped their child's mood, and that our hospital should have a permanent IM consult service. CONCLUSION Integrative therapies can be helpful to address pain without significant side effects. Further studies are needed to investigate the integration, cost, and cost-effectiveness of integrative therapies in pediatric hospitals.

Pados BF, McGlothen-Bell K. Benefits of Infant Massage for Infants and Parents in the NICU. Nurs Womens Health 2019; 23:265-271. Abstract
Infant massage is an ancient therapeutic technique used around the world. For infants who experience painful procedures, are exposed to the stressful NICU environment, and are separated from their parents, infant massage has been promoted as a method to reduce stress and promote bonding. In this article, we review the current literature on infant massage in the NICU. There is evidence that infant massage has beneficial effects on preterm infants in the NICU, including shorter length of stay; reduced pain; and improved weight gain, feeding tolerance, and neurodevelopment. Parents who performed massage with their infants in the NICU reported experiencing less stress, anxiety, and depression. Neonatal nurses can obtain education and certification in infant massage and can teach parents infant massage techniques, thereby promoting the health and well-being of parent-infant dyads.

EEG captures affective touch: CT-optimal touch and neural oscillations. COGNITIVE AFFECTIVE & BEHAVIORAL NEUROSCIENCE 2019; 18:155-166. Abstract
Tactile interactions are of developmental importance to social and emotional interactions across species. In beginning to understand the affective component of tactile stimulation, research has begun to elucidate the neural mechanisms that underscore slow, affective touch. Here, we extended this emerging body of work and examined whether affective touch (C tactile [CT]-optimal speed), as compared to nonaffective touch (non-CT-optimal speed) and no touch conditions, modulated EEG oscillations. We report an attenuation in alpha and beta activity to affective and nonaffective touch relative to the no touch condition. Further, we found an attenuation in theta activity specific to the affective, as compared to the nonaffective touch and no touch conditions. Similar to theta, we also observed an attenuation of beta oscillations during the affective touch condition, although only in parietal scalp sites. Decreased activity in theta and parietal-beta ranges may reflect attentional-emotional regulatory mechanisms; however, future work is needed to provide insight into the potential neural coupling between theta and beta and their specific role in encoding slow, tactile stimulation.

von Mohr M, Kirsch LP, Fotopoulou A. The soothing function of touch: affective touch reduces feelings of social exclusion. Sci Rep 2017; 7:13516. Abstract
The mammalian need for social proximity, attachment and belonging may have an adaptive and evolutionary value in terms of survival and reproductive success. Consequently, ostracism may induce strong negative feelings of social exclusion. Recent studies suggest that slow, affective touch, which is mediated by a separate, specific C tactile neurophysiological system than faster, neutral touch, modulates the perception of physical pain. However, it remains unknown whether slow, affective touch, can also reduce feelings of social exclusion, a form of social pain. Here, we employed a social exclusion paradigm, namely the Cyberball task (N = 84), to examine whether the administration of slow, affective touch may reduce the negative feelings of ostracism induced by the social exclusion manipulations of the Cyberball task. As predicted, the provision of slow-affective, as compared to fast-neutral, touch led to a specific decrease in feelings of social exclusion, beyond general mood effects. These findings point to the soothing function of slow, affective touch, particularly in the context of social separation or rejection, and suggest a specific relation between affective touch and social bonding.

Krahé C, Drabek MM, Paloyelis Y, Fotopoulou A. Affective touch and attachment style modulate pain: a laser-evoked potentials study. Philos Trans R Soc Lond B Biol Sci 2016; 371:rstb.2016.0009. Abstract
Affective touch and cutaneous pain are two sub-modalities of interoception with contrasting affective qualities (pleasantness/unpleasantness) and social meanings (care/harm), yet their direct relationship has not been investigated. In 50 women, taking into account individual attachment styles, we assessed the role of affective touch and particularly the contribution of the C tactile (CT) system in subjective and electrophysiological responses to noxious skin stimulation, namely N1 and N2-P2 laser-evoked potentials. When pleasant, slow (versus fast) velocity touch was administered to the (non-CT-containing) palm of the hand, higher attachment anxiety predicted increased subjective pain ratings, in the same direction as changes in N2 amplitude. By contrast, when pleasant touch was administered to CT-containing skin of the arm, higher attachment anxiety predicted attenuated N1 and N2 amplitudes. Higher attachment avoidance predicted opposite results. Thus, CT-based affective touch can modulate pain in early and late processing stages (N1 and N2 components), with the direction of effects depending on attachment style. Affective touch not involving the CT system seems to affect predominately the conscious perception of pain, possibly reflecting socio-cognitive factors further up the neurocognitive hierarchy. Affective touch may thus convey information about available social resources and gate pain responses depending on individual expectations of social support.
